Warning Signs You Need Supply Line Break Water Removal

Catching these signs early can save you money and prevent bigger problems. Don’t ignore these warning signs: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

If you notice persistent musty odors in your home, it may be a sign of a supply line break. Don’t ignore it, act quickly to prevent mold and mildew growth.

Water Spots or Leaks

Water spots or leaks on your ceiling, walls, or floors can show a supply line issue. Address it quickly to prevent further damage.

Warped or Buckled Floors

If your floors are warped or buckled, it may be a sign of water damage from a supply line break. Don’t delay, contact our team for prompt help.

Unusual Noises

Unusual noises, such as creaking or gurgling sounds, can show a supply line issue. Don’t ignore it, act quickly to prevent further damage.

Discoloration or Warping

Discoloration or warping of walls, ceilings, or floors can show water damage from a supply line break. Don’t delay, contact our team for prompt help.

Mold or Mildew Growth

Mold or mildew growth can be a sign of water damage from a supply line break. Don’t ignore it, act quickly to prevent health risks.

Supply Line Break Water Removal Cost in Port Neches, TX

The cost of supply line break water removal services can vary depending on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ions in Port Neches, TX. Our estimates are based on the following services:

ServiceTypical Price RangeWhat Affects Cost
Assessment and Extraction$500 – $2,500Severity of damage and size of affected area.
Drying and Dehumidification$1,000 – $5,000Size of affected area and duration of drying process.
Restoration and Repair$2,000 – $10,000Severity of damage and type of materials affected.
Final Inspection and Cleaning$500 – $2,000Size of affected area and type of cleaning required.

Exact pricing depends on an on-site assessment. We offer free estimates for all our services.
